Job Description

Support Worker

We are pleased to announce we have an exciting opportunity here at Potens for a Support Worker.

Females only due to the needs of the service.

Primavera House is a supported living service based in Aldershot that supports 6 young adults with learning disabilities epilepsy and/or autism to live as independently as possible within their local community.

This is a transitional service that supports young adults in developing their life skills and in doing so helps to nurture their potential and encourages them to be active members of their community.

What well give you:

We will ensure you are rewarded for all your hard work which is why we offer a comprehensive benefits package that includes but is not limited to:

  • 12.21 per hour.
  • 40 hours per week.
  • Will involve a variety of shifts including early and late shifts. May occasionally be asked to help with a waking night to cover annual leave.
  • Working alternate weekends. Bank holiday working is also required.
  • Contributory pension scheme.
  • Confidential supportive Employee Assistance Programme accessible 24/7.
  • Paid comprehensive learning and development opportunities so we can invest in your future including internal leadership competency sessions and recognised qualifications (level 2 to level 5 NVQ in Health & Social Care).
  • New to care You can complete your Care Certificate with us.
  • Access to attractive and exclusive employee benefits including savings on shopping leisure and household expenses.
  • A generous referral scheme.

What youll be doing:

  • Providing specialist care for 6 young adults who have learning disabilities epilepsy and/or autism.
  • Supporting 1-1 and promoting positive well-being.
  • Working to maintain a high level of support thats required for the service needs.
  • Participating in the chosen activities and interests of the people we support.
  • Maintain and develop their community links as well as accessing community and leisure pursuits to support their independent living and life skills.

Who you are:

  • You will be able to work independently multitask organise and prioritise your work to suit the people we support.
  • You are exceptional at building relationships with strong communication skills.
  • You are motivated and can maintain a positive attitude under pressure.
  • You are a quick learner hands on and willing to take part in the chosen activities of the people we support.
  • Previous experience supporting people with similar needs in a similar setting is preferred but not essential.
  • You are flexible with the ability to work a variety of shifts including early and late occasionally be asked to help with a waking night to cover annual leave.
  • Females only due to the needs of the service.
